About

Dice 'n Goblins is a single player role playing game. It was developed by Tsukumogami Software and was released on April 4, 2025. It received very positive reviews from players.

Explore a mysterious dungeon in this dungeon-crawler RPG. You are Gobby, a small goblin wanting to find an exit from this seemingly infinite dungeon. But beware! Deadly traps, mad monsters, and even humans infest the labyrinth. Worse, it seems the place is only growing! Exploration Discover 10 interconnected levels with classic grid-like controls.   • The game features an adorable art style and charming characters, making it visually appealing and engaging.
  • The unique dice-driven combat system adds depth and strategy to the gameplay, allowing for meaningful choices and satisfying combos.
  • Exploration is enjoyable with well-designed levels and a cozy atmosphere, making it accessible for both newcomers and veterans of the genre.
  • Some players have reported issues with the controls and UI, which can feel unresponsive and frustrating at times.
  • The game can lack direction, leading to confusion about objectives and progression, especially in longer corridors.
  • There are minor bugs and glitches present, such as incorrect health displays and occasional softlocks during traversal.

    The gameplay of "Dice 'n Goblins" is characterized by its charming art style and engaging tactical turn-based combat, with a standout dice mechanic that adds a fun layer of strategy. Players appreciate the balance between luck and skill, as well as the game's forgiving nature, making it accessible while still challenging in the late game. Overall, it offers a delightful dungeon-crawling experience that appeals to fans of tabletop RPGs.

    • “The art style is clean and charming, with expressive goblin characters and readable environments that keep the focus on gameplay.”
    • “If you enjoy tactical turn-based combat, dice mechanics done right, or compact RPGs with a strong design focus, Dice 'n Goblins is an easy recommendation.”
    • “It's a lovingly crafted dungeon crawler with a unique dice mechanic.”
    • “It doesn't punish the player much when dying and is easy to work through the fight mechanics.”
    • “It is a bit on the easier side for most of the game, as long as your luck isn't awful and you understand probability/push your luck mechanics, but the late game really makes you think about your build and be flexible about changing it to suit conditions.”
    • “The dice mechanics are the star of the show.”
